Russia Will Return on Dec. 1 to Old
System of Nation-Wide Day of Rest
Moscow, Nov. 24.-(P)-Russia prepared Tuesday to return to a national day of rest on Dec. 1, by authority of the council of the people's commissars.

The holiday "stagger system under which industry kept going continuously, Sunday, Monday and every other day. while the "day off" for the workers varied with the individual's preferences or the arrangements among trades, is to be abandoned.

Except for co-operative stores, dining halls, transportation and other agencies serving the cultural and living needs of the people, the holiday for everyone will fall every sixth day.

It will not fall on a fixed day of the week, however, and Sunday will be recognized no more than under the present regime.

The sixth, twelfth, eighteenth, twenty-fourth and thirtieth days of the month will be the holidays. Working hours will be reduced, at the same time, from 7 to 6 hours a day.

A gradual change to the longer and uninterrupted week has been in progress in various sections of the country. particularly in the large industrial centers, since Joseph Stalin's speech last June in which he said a number of faults had been found in the five-day. uninterrupted week.

Breakdowns of machinery were frequent because of inexperienced relief shifts supplanting regular workers. there was little time to repair machines and responsible authority was improperly distributed on regular officials' days off.

The action was regarded here as the most important since the introduction of the piecework system of wages.
